Description

½ Gold Friedrich from Kingdom of Prussia. Issued from 1802 to 1816. Struck in Gold (.903). Measures 20.5 mm and weighs 3.34 g.

Obverse
Uniformed bust facing left.
Reverse
Crowned prussian eagle holding scepter and imperial orb in its paws sitting on top of war trophies. Date and mintmark at bottom.
